Subject: tools: Adopt __packed from kernel sources
Patch-mainline: v4.13-rc1
Git-commit: c9f5da742fa3dfebc49d03deb312522e5db643ed
References: bsc#1109837

To have a more compact way to ask the compiler to not insert alignment
paddings in a struct, making tools/ look more like kernel source code.
